Choosing the Right Sump Pump for Your Basement Needs

Protecting your home's foundation from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many options available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the size of your basement and the amount of rainfall your area typically experiences. A robust pump may be necessary if you live in a region prone to heavy storms.

It's also important to select between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the basin. Submersible pumps are generally more efficient, but pedestal pumps may be easier to maintain.

Finally, don't forget about a alternate power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.

Troubleshooting Common Sump Pump Issues

A sump pump is a vital system for protecting your house from inundation. While they are generally reliable, there are some common issues that can arise. Here's a look at some of the most frequent sump pump concerns and how to address them.

One common issue is a failing mechanism. If the mechanism isn't detecting water, the pump won't kick in. Inspect the mechanism for debris.

Another common cause is a blocked outlet. This can occur from trash accumulating in the tube. Clear the channel to enhance water flow.

Finally, a faulty pump unit is another option. If your pump won't start, it may be time to replace the pump unit. Routine inspections can help prevent these common issues.
